Target of the research
By fusing nanomechanical devices capable of handling minute vibrations (phonons) with light, electricity and magnetism, we aim to realize cutting-edge applications such as ultra-energy-saving photoelectric conversion and ultra-sensitive charge and magnetic detection, as well as to develop new physics based on the interaction of phonons with photons, electrons and spins, and to extract new functions that have never been done before.
